Senior Minister for Information Technology (IT), Shahram Tarakai, has advised the management of IT department to make all necessary arrangements to provide free WiFi round the clock within the campuses that come under the radar of their Open WiFi project. The decision comes in the light of “KP Open WiFi” project, which entails accessibility to free and open WiFi across Khyber Pakhtunkhwa.
In addition to open Wifi, Shahram also gave feedback about different IT initiatives introduced under KP Information Technology Board. While chairing the meeting, Shahram showed special interest in developing initiatives for youth employment in the province.
“Empowerment of youth is on the top of the priority list of the PTI-led provincial government as they are the future of our nation and as such the provincial government is investing more and more on their empowerment.”, he added while speaking to media.
Shahram encouraged the management to focus on youth-oriented projects.
